The Tidal Model: A Guide for Mental Health ProfessionalsRoutledge, 1 de nov. 2004 - 304 pàgines The Tidal Model represents a significant alternative to mainstream mental health theories, emphasising how those suffering from mental health problems can benefit from taking a more active role in their own treatment. |
